KSA bars chronically ill from performing Hajj

Published : Tuesday, 11 November, 2025 at 12:00 AM  Count : 437
The Saudi government has announced that people suffering from chronic diseases will not be allowed to perform Hajj.
Bangladesh's Ministry of Religious Affairs on Monday said it had received a letter from the Saudi Ministry of Hajj and Umrah regarding the matter.

The Saudi ministry has asked all countries sending pilgrims to conduct full health check-ups for every pilgrim. Each pilgrim must provide a medical certificate confirming they are fit and free from health risks to perform Hajj.

Those with major organ failures, including patients undergoing kidney dialysis, those with serious heart or lung diseases requiring constant oxygen support, and people with severe liver cirrhosis, will not be allowed.
